oracle表空間滿了怎么處理
網絡資訊
2023-05-22 22:25
731
Oracle數據庫是一種非常流行的關系型數據庫管理系統,用于存儲和管理大型數據集。在使用Oracle數據庫時,用戶可能會面臨各種挑戰和問題,其中一個主要問題是當Oracle表空間滿了時該怎么處理。本文將重點討論Oracle表空間滿了的處理方法。
首先,我們需要了解什么是Oracle表空間。表空間是Oracle數據庫中數據的邏輯存儲區域,它由一個或多個數據文件組成,用于存儲表、索引、視圖和其他數據庫對象。當表空間滿了后,數據庫將無法存儲更多的數據,從而會影響數據庫性能和可用性。
接下來,我們將討論Oracle表空間滿了的處理方法。以下是幾種可行的解決方案:
1.增加表空間的大小。我們可以通過添加新的數據文件或者擴展現有的數據文件來增加表空間的大小。這個方法需要注意的是,我們需要先查看表空間的大小和使用情況,并且還需要確保有足夠的磁盤空間來存儲新的數據文件。
2.壓縮和清理數據。壓縮和清理數據可以有效地減小表空間的大小。我們可以刪除不再需要的數據、清理日志文件或是使用壓縮技術對數據進行壓縮來減小表空間的大小。
3.移動數據到新的表空間。我們可以將數據從滿了的表空間中轉移到新的表空間中。這個方法需要一定的計劃和管理,需要確保新的表空間滿足存儲需求,并且在移動數據之前需要備份數據庫。
4.刪除不必要的數據庫對象。我們可以刪除不再使用的表、視圖、索引或其他數據庫對象來釋放表空間。這種方法需要仔細評估需要刪除的對象,確保不會刪除關鍵數據。
在處理Oracle表空間滿了的問題時,我們需要重點考慮以下幾個方面:
1.了解數據庫的狀態。我們需要了解數據庫的當前狀態,包括表空間的使用情況、數據庫的性能和可用性,并根據這些信息來選擇合適的解決方案。
2.計劃和預測未來的需求。我們需要預測未來的需求并考慮數據庫增長的趨勢,然后制定相應的計劃來處理表空間滿了的問題,并確保計劃不會影響數據庫的性能和可用性。
3.備份和恢復數據。在處理表空間滿了的問題時,我們需要備份數據庫并確保數據的完整性和可恢復性。在移動或刪除數據時,我們需要謹慎操作,避免誤操作導致數據丟失。
綜上所述,Oracle表空間滿了是一個常見的問題,但我們可以通過增加表空間的大小、壓縮和清理數據、移動數據到新的表空間或刪除不必要的數據庫對象等方法來進行處理。我們需要謹慎地評估和選擇這些解決方案,并考慮到數據庫的狀態和未來的需求,同時確保備份和恢復數據。
活動:慈云數據爆款香港服務器,CTG+CN2高速帶寬、快速穩定、平均延遲10+ms 速度快,免備案,每月僅需19元!!
首先,我們需要了解什么是Oracle表空間。表空間是Oracle數據庫中數據的邏輯存儲區域,它由一個或多個數據文件組成,用于存儲表、索引、視圖和其他數據庫對象。當表空間滿了后,數據庫將無法存儲更多的數據,從而會影響數據庫性能和可用性。
接下來,我們將討論Oracle表空間滿了的處理方法。以下是幾種可行的解決方案:
1.增加表空間的大小。我們可以通過添加新的數據文件或者擴展現有的數據文件來增加表空間的大小。這個方法需要注意的是,我們需要先查看表空間的大小和使用情況,并且還需要確保有足夠的磁盤空間來存儲新的數據文件。
2.壓縮和清理數據。壓縮和清理數據可以有效地減小表空間的大小。我們可以刪除不再需要的數據、清理日志文件或是使用壓縮技術對數據進行壓縮來減小表空間的大小。
3.移動數據到新的表空間。我們可以將數據從滿了的表空間中轉移到新的表空間中。這個方法需要一定的計劃和管理,需要確保新的表空間滿足存儲需求,并且在移動數據之前需要備份數據庫。
4.刪除不必要的數據庫對象。我們可以刪除不再使用的表、視圖、索引或其他數據庫對象來釋放表空間。這種方法需要仔細評估需要刪除的對象,確保不會刪除關鍵數據。
在處理Oracle表空間滿了的問題時,我們需要重點考慮以下幾個方面:
1.了解數據庫的狀態。我們需要了解數據庫的當前狀態,包括表空間的使用情況、數據庫的性能和可用性,并根據這些信息來選擇合適的解決方案。
2.計劃和預測未來的需求。我們需要預測未來的需求并考慮數據庫增長的趨勢,然后制定相應的計劃來處理表空間滿了的問題,并確保計劃不會影響數據庫的性能和可用性。
3.備份和恢復數據。在處理表空間滿了的問題時,我們需要備份數據庫并確保數據的完整性和可恢復性。在移動或刪除數據時,我們需要謹慎操作,避免誤操作導致數據丟失。
綜上所述,Oracle表空間滿了是一個常見的問題,但我們可以通過增加表空間的大小、壓縮和清理數據、移動數據到新的表空間或刪除不必要的數據庫對象等方法來進行處理。我們需要謹慎地評估和選擇這些解決方案,并考慮到數據庫的狀態和未來的需求,同時確保備份和恢復數據。
活動:慈云數據爆款香港服務器,CTG+CN2高速帶寬、快速穩定、平均延遲10+ms 速度快,免備案,每月僅需19元!!
標籤:
- 數據庫
- 空間
- 刪除
- Oracle
- 確保
- 壓縮
- 處理
- 存儲
- 方法
- 清理